What is the impact of financial education in promoting investment in infrastructure in Guatemala?
Financial education has a significant impact on promoting investment in infrastructure in Guatemala. By providing knowledge about the financial aspects of infrastructure projects, the sources of financing available, and the risks and benefits associated with these types of investments, financial education empowers investors and decision makers to evaluate and promote investments. in infrastructure in a more informed way. Financial education also teaches about long-term financing options, such as public-private partnerships and infrastructure bonds, and promotes a greater understanding of the business models and economic and social considerations involved in infrastructure projects. This contributes to the development and modernization of infrastructure in Guatemala, improving the quality of life of the population and promoting sustainable economic growth.

What are the requirements to obtain authorization for a commercial premises in Argentina?
The requirements to obtain authorization for a commercial premises in Argentina vary depending on the jurisdiction and local regulations. Generally, it is required to submit an application to the corresponding municipality, comply with the established safety and hygiene requirements, obtain land use authorization and pay the corresponding fees.

What is the situation of technical and professional education in Venezuela?
Technical and professional education in Venezuela has faced problems such as lack of investment, obsolescence of study programs and disconnection with the needs of the labor market, which limits employment opportunities and economic development.
How is the amount of alimony determined in Bolivia?
The amount of alimony in Bolivia is determined considering various factors, such as the income of the parents, the needs of the children and other related expenses. The court will evaluate these circumstances to establish a fair and equitable amount.
